WebAug 5, 2024 · A hybrid solution is a strategy profile that is stable against deviations by every subcoalition of any coalition included in a given partition of the players set. More precisely, any subcoalition of a given coalition can be prevented from not choosing the solution because the players remaining in the coalition can use suitable blocking strategies. WebJun 6, 2024 · A Hybrid Electric Vehicle is a type of vehicle that uses a combination of an Internal Combustion (IC) engine and an electric propulsion system. The electric powertrain may enhance fuel efficiency, increase performance, or independently propel the vehicle on pure electric power, depending on the type of hybrid system.

WebMay 1, 2024 · With this definition, one can show that the set of strong hybrid solution is a subset of the Yang and Yuan’s hybrid solutions, which are themselves a subset of Zhao’s hybrid solutions. Hence the assertion that the notion of strong hybrid solution is a refinement of the hybrid solution.
